  • Description: 3-dehydroquinate synthase

Gene name aroB
Synonyms
Essential no
Product 3-dehydroquinate synthase
Function biosynthesis of aromatic amino acids
MW, pI 40 kDa, 6.937
Gene length, protein length 1086 bp, 362 aa
Immediate neighbours aroH, aroF
